Vegetable Pizza

You won't believe it's vegan or healthy! This vegetable pizza is made with oil-free pizza dough, vegan ranch sauce, and a variety of chopped vegetables. Each bite is a savory bit of veggie goodness in your mouth.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Total Time35 minutes
Course: Entrees
Cuisine: American
Diet: Vegan
Servings: 12 servings
Calories: 109kcal

Ingredients

Vegetable Pizza Dough

Ranch Dressing Sauce

Vegetable Toppings: ½ cup each

  • Carrots shredded
  • Yellow Baby Bell Peppers sliced
  • Red Bell Peppers diced
  • Broccolini chopped
  • Green Onions and White Onions chopped
  • Microgreens
  • Purple Cabbage chopped

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ees
  • Prepare the dough according to the oil-free pizza dough directions.
  • Now, prepare the ranch dressing, following the recipe (alter the recipe by reducing water to ½ cup water instead of 3.4 cup water); set aside.
  • Using a large parchment paper, roll the dough with some excess flour onto the parchment paper to transfer it onto a baking sheet.
  • Once transferred, use your hands to move the dough into the pan's corners, pushing it into the corner to form a rectangle.
  • Now, poke holes in the dough with a sharp knife to prevent the dough from bubbling when it cooks.
  • Bake crust for 20 minutes, and allow to cool completely before adding the ranch sauce.
  • Spread a thin layer of vegan ranch dressing over the crust's surface evenly.
  • Sprinkle with the chopped toppings
  • Cut and serve
